  • What is 8086 microprocessor brief notes?

    8086 microprocessor made up of 29,000 MOS transistors and could work at a clock speed of 5-10 MHz. It has a 16-bit ALU with 16-bit data bus and 20-bit address bus. It can address up to 1MB of address space. The pipelining concept was used for the first time to improve the speed of the processor.
  • What are the key points of 8086 microprocessor?

    SALIENT FEATURES OF 8086 MICROPROCESSOR

    Single +5V power supply.Clock speed range of 5-10MHz.capable of executing about 0.33 MIPS (Millions instructions per second)It is 16-bit processor having 16-bit ALU, 16-bit registers, internal data bus, and 16-bit external data bus resulting in faster processing.
  • What are the 14 registers of 8086?

    The 8086 has 14 16 bits registers. AX, BX, CX, DX, SI, DI, BP, SP, CS, DS, SS, ES, IP and the flags register. The last two are only accessed indirectly.
